For example, employees who experience all three dimensions of burnout are four times more likely to leave the company than employees who do not experience any of these dimensions. And while self-reported productivity tends to be lower among employees who experience only a single dimension of burnout (about 13 points on our 100-point scale), it was higher among employees who experienced all three dimensions of burnout in our most recent survey have an average of 22 points lower.

It is important that a significantly smaller group of employees experience all three dimensions of burnout. This means that it is not too late to help people, and examining the specific stressors offers a way forward.
